Philip pioneered the use of two chiral spectroscopies-magnetic circular dichroism (MCD) and vibrational circular dichroism (VCD)-and the application of density functional theory (DFT) of IR and VCD spectra to to ascertain the absolute molecular configurations of organic molecules and biomolecules. He applied these techniques to study a diverse group of systems, ranging from small chiral organic molecules and natural products to heme proteins and blue copper proteins to the iron-sulfur complex in ferredoxin, a protein that transfers electrons.
Phllip's techniques have been applied in the pharmaceutical industry to determine drug structures, help calculate safe temperatures for accelerated stability studies, and to screen for better drug candidates and formulations.
He wrote more than 200 published papers across many areas of chemistry. He received an Alfred P. Sloan Foundation Fellowship, a Guggenheim Fellowship, and the USC Associates Award for Creative Scholarship & Research. Philip was named a Fellow of the Royal Society in 2008.
